Interesting read on chn from the chl side. Said they’re expecting some of these guys may end up coming back at the break after realizing the ncaa isn’t going to be all it’s cracked up to be and that the money difference really won’t be worth it for most guys. Going to be a very interesting time of flux between the leagues and wonder if this will spur the chl to ramp their payments

Solid pickup. Not a game changer but seemed very steady on the backend in the ushl and is the guy that pushes out Phillips a year. Definitely raises the floor on the backend for next year.

Would still like to see them find 1-2 impact forwards to add a little scoring but either way it’s going to be a very young team going into next year in terms of college years with only 4 seniors (lamb, mitts x2 and Thomas) with 2 additional upperclassmen skaters (Clark Ludtke).

Was always going to be a bit of a transition year because of that and is probably part of why we’ve been less active as pushing out ntdpers has always been difficult with their expectations
